Are you ready ?" "Ready!" hissed Farley venomously.
"Ready," nodded Dave coolly.
"Time!" With a yell Farley leaped in.

He didn't want it to last more than one round, if it could be helped.
The fury of his assault drove the lighter Darrin back.

Farley followed up with more sledge-hammers.

He was certainly a dangerous man, with a hurricane style.

He was fast and heavy, calculated to bear down a lighter opponent.
Before that assortment of blows Dave Darrin was forced to resort to footwork.
"Stand up and fight!" jeered Farley harshly as he wheeled and wheeled, still throwing out his hammer blows.
